One of Georgia’s top commitments in the 2023 cycle had quite the game on Friday night. Jesuit (Tampa, Fla.) linebacker Troy Bowles was nothing short of dominant in a big win over Gaither in a regional semifinal game.
Bowles, the son of Tampa Bay Buccaneers head coach Todd Bowles, had three interceptions in the game and he returned two of them for touchdowns. In all, he had 140 interception return yards in the game.

At 6-feet 206 pounds, Bowles is the fifth highest-ranked prospect in UGA’s 2023 class. He is the nation’s No. 77 overall prospect and No. 5 linebacker according the the On3 consensus. He’s the No. 16 player in Florida.
“Box linebacker that has the ability to key and diagnose as good as anyone in the country. Son of NFL coach Todd Bowles. Jumped a 5’06” high jump in 2022 and ran 11.73 in the 100m in 2021. Striker that sees the field extremely well and triggers to the ball quickly. Instinctive player that will lay the wood consistently. Plays faster than a watch will have him in the 40 or on the track. More of a box player that can thump and be disruptive in the run game. Lacks size and stature for the position, measuring around 6-feet, 205 pounds going into his senior season. Has some hip stiffness and will need to prove his overall ability to play sideline to sideline at the next level. With his physicality and field awareness he has a high floor and will always be around the football.” — On3 Recruiting
Georgia currently ranks No. 2 in the 2023 On3 Consensus team rankings. Alabama is the only team ahead. The Bulldogs have 20 total commitments after Gulliver Prep cornerback Daniel Harris de-committed earlier this week. Bowles is one of three four-star linebackers Georgia has committed for the 2023 class, joining Raylen Wilson (Lincoln; Tallahassee, Fla.) and CJ Allen (Lamar County; Barnesville, Ga.)
